Sunday Service, May 5 – William Ellery Channing: The Baltimore Pentecost

A graduate of Harvard College and a titan of Unitarian Universalist thought, William Ellery Channing delivered a historic 1819 sermon from the pulpit of First Unitarian Church in Baltimore.  His sermon defined American Unitarianism. Please see Congregation News for more information.
